If the application is unable to identify the subscription, you may try a few steps from below:
1. Logout from Acrobat Reader Mobile;
2. Restart the device;
3. Log in back to the device.
If these do not work, you may try restoring the subscription. Please refer to the link to learn how to restore the subscription: Manage subscriptions — Adobe Scan for iOS
Also, you might want to check if you are logged in using Apple ID and not Google.
